    Why do we have to witness the moon (full or cresent) with our shock eyes. I witness the one God and many other things through reason and calculation.

    So once I have seen and known the position of the moon through trial and error I know exactly where it's going to be in the future. It's not like you are predicting rain.

    Even calculations require INPUT so that they give you a meaningful output. Hence, you still have to decide whether "shahr" means "full-moon" or means "new crescent moon" and do your calculations accordingly. There is no way around that decision.
